Several things change the final quote for a hardscape project. The biggest factor is the size of the area you want covered, followed by the specific materials you choose. Natural stone, for example, usually costs more than standard concrete pavers. You also have to consider site prep; if the ground needs significant grading or old materials removed, that adds labor hours. Installing patio pavers in Savannah involves several key steps. First, licensed pros assess the site and prepare the area by excavating and grading. A robust base of compacted gravel and sand is then laid down, which is crucial for drainage and stability in our climate. The pavers are carefully placed according to the design, ensuring they are level and aligned. Finally, the joints are filled with sand, and the surface is compacted one last time. This process ensures a beautiful and long-lasting patio.

Outdoor patio tiles and pavers offer different aesthetics and installation methods for your Savannah patio. Pavers are individual units that interlock, creating a flexible surface that can handle ground movement. Patio tiles, often made of ceramic or porcelain, are typically set on a mortar bed or specialized base. Both can create beautiful outdoor spaces. The pros can discuss the pros and cons of each, considering factors like maintenance, durability, and your desired look for your outdoor patio.
In Savannah, hardscaping encompasses the non-living, structural elements of your outdoor space. This includes patios, walkways, driveways, retaining walls, and outdoor kitchens constructed from materials like pavers, concrete, or stone. It's the functional framework that defines and enhances your property's usability and appearance. Unlike softscaping, which deals with plants, hardscaping provides the solid, enduring features.
